Add a News Widget

You can add a News widget to Citizen Portal that will pull news articles from the news categories on your website. With a News widget, you can easily display any news articles in one central location in Citizen Portal.

Set-up instructions

In the administrator side of Citizen Portal:

  1. Select the “Widgets” tab from the top menu
  2. Select “Add Widget” from the “Add Widget” button near the top right of the page
  3. Select “News” from the page of available widgets

This will take you to the new news widget details page.

News widget details

Once you’ve added the news widget, you can customize the way the widget will appear on Citizen Portal. This includes setting up the configuration, content and notifications for the widget. 

Configuration

To configure the News widget, select "Configuration" from the side menu. Then complete each of the necessary fields. Once you've completed all necessary fields, select the "Next" button at the bottom of the screen to take you to the "Content" screen. Alternatively, you can select "Content" from the side menu.

In the “Widget name” field, enter a name for the news widget. For example, you could use one of the following names:
  • Emergency Alerts
  • Council News
  • Recreation News

The widget name will appear at the top of the widget on the public-facing side of the portal.

If you would like this widget to be fixed on the user’s portal, select the “Set as fixed widget” checkbox. If you select this option, a user will not be able to remove the widget.

In the “Widget colour” field, enter the hex code for the background icon colour. You may type the hex code into this field using the format of #XXXXXX. You may also select this colour from the colour grid that appears when you click into this widget colour field.

You can select a widget icon from our library or upload your own widget icon. If you'd like to choose an icon from the library:

  • Choose the "Select icon from library" option
  • Then, select the "Select icon" button to view the library
  • Choose the icon you'd like from the library 

If you'd like to upload your own icon:

  • Choose the "Upload icon" option
  • Then, select the  “Add icon”
  • From the pop-up box, choose the widget icon file from your documents

Please note that this must be a .svg file that is less than 5KB.

Content

Once you've completed the "Configuration" set-up, you can add content to the widget. Select "Content" from the side menu and complete all necessary fields. Once you've added content, you can select the "Next" button at the bottom of the screen or select "Notifications" from the side menu.

Beneath “News categories”, you will find a list of news categories that will be auto-populated from your website. Select the checkbox next to each news category that you’d like to show in this widget.

For example, if you wanted to make a widget just showing Council news from your Council news category, you would only select the checkbox next to the “Council News” category.

From the “Dashboard items” dropdown menu, select the number of new articles that you’d like to appear on the widget within the citizen dashboard. We recommend including three news article entries.

From the “Expanded view items” dropdown menu, select the number of news articles you’d like to appear on the expanded view. The expanded view will display if someone selects a dashboard item to view more details. We suggest displaying five entries in the expanded view.

Enter any text you would like to appear above your news in the dashboard widget view. For example, if you would like to add a link so users can subscribe for updates, you could type “Subscribe for updates” and add a hyperlink to this page on your website or within Citizen Portal.

If you would like the text in expanded view to mirror the dashboard view, select the checkbox next to “Use dashboard text for expanded view”.

If you would like to add content above the events within expanded view, add text within the “Expanded View” textbox.

Notifications

If you would like Citizen Portal to notify users that have subscribed to updates, select the “Widget Notification” toggle to turn on notifications.

Saving and publishing the widget settings

To save these settings and add the news widget to Citizen Portal, select the “Save” button.
